From: John Melton - G0ORX <john.d.melton@googlemail.c>
Date: Sun, 12 Nov 2017 10:49:41 +0000 (+0000)
Subject: updated release directory for 1.2
X-Git-Url: https://git.rkrishnan.org/pf/components/nxhtml.html?a=commitdiff_plain;h=1f827446f5b352aac61072f84f437fdfb0660241;p=pihpsdr.git

updated release directory for 1.2
---

diff --git a/release/pihpsdr/install.sh b/release/pihpsdr/install.sh
index 6098a1f..34bbfdb 100755
--- a/release/pihpsdr/install.sh
+++ b/release/pihpsdr/install.sh
@@ -1,23 +1,42 @@
+echo "installing fftw"
 sudo apt-get -y install libfftw3-3
-sudo apt-get -y install xscreensaver
-echo "removing old shared libraries"
+echo "removing old versions of pihpsdr"
+sudo rm -rf /usr/local/bin/pihpsdr
+echo "creating start script"
+cat <<EOT > start_pihpsdr.sh
+cd `pwd`
+sudo /usr/local/bin/pihpsdr
+EOT
+echo "creating desktop shortcut"
+cat <<EOT > pihpsdr.desktop
+#!/usr/bin/env xdg-open
+[Desktop Entry]
+Version=1.0
+Type=Application
+Terminal=false
+Name[eb_GB]=piHPSDR
+Exec=`pwd`/start_pihpsdr.sh
+Icon=`pwd`/hpsdr_icon.png
+Name=piHPSDR
+EOT
+cp pihpsdr.dshesktop ~/Desktop
+if [ ! -d "~/.local" ]; then
+  mkdir ~/.local
+fi
+if [ ! -d "~/.local/share" ]; then
+mkdir ~/.local/share
+fi
+if [ ! -d "~/.local/share/applications" ]; then
+mkdir ~/.local/share/applications
+fi
+cp pihpsdr.desktop ~/.local/share/applications
+echo "removing old versions of shared libraries"
 sudo rm -rf /usr/local/lib/libwdsp.so
-sudo rm -rf /usr/local/lib/libpsk.so
 sudo rm -rf /usr/local/lib/libcodec2.*
-sudo rm -rf /usr/local/lib/libSoapySDR.*
+echo "installing pihpsdr"
+sudo cp pihpsdr /usr/local/bin
 echo "installing shared libraries"
 sudo cp libwdsp.so /usr/local/lib
-sudo cp libpsk.so /usr/local/lib
-sudo cp libcodec2.so.0.5 /usr/local/lib
-sudo cp libSoapySDR.so.0.5-1 /usr/local/lib
-cd /usr/local/lib; sudo ln -s libcodec2.so.0.5 libcodec2.so
-cd /usr/local/lib; sudo ln -s libSoapySDR.so.0.5-1 libSoapySDR.so.0.5.0
-cd /usr/local/lib; sudo ln -s libSoapySDR.so.0.5-1 libSoapySDR.so
+sudo cp libcodec2.so.0.7 /usr/local/lib
+cd /usr/local/lib; sudo ln -s libcodec2.so.0.7 libcodec2.so
 sudo ldconfig
-echo "setting up for USB OZY device"
-cd ~/pihpsdr
-sudo cp 90-ozy.rules /etc/udev/rules.d
-sudo udevadm control --reload-rules
-echo "creating desktop icon"
-cp pihpsdr.desktop ~/Desktop
-cp pihpsdr.desktop ~/.local/share/applications
diff --git a/release/pihpsdr/latest b/release/pihpsdr/latest
deleted file mode 100644
index 3c61df3..0000000
--- a/release/pihpsdr/latest
+++ /dev/null
@@ -1 +0,0 @@
-v1.1.1-beta
diff --git a/release/pihpsdr/libcodec2.so.0.5 b/release/pihpsdr/libcodec2.so.0.5
deleted file mode 100755
index 364d31c..0000000
Binary files a/release/pihpsdr/libcodec2.so.0.5 and /dev/null differ
diff --git a/release/pihpsdr/libcodec2.so.0.7 b/release/pihpsdr/libcodec2.so.0.7
new file mode 100755
index 0000000..5038f4f
Binary files /dev/null and b/release/pihpsdr/libcodec2.so.0.7 differ
diff --git a/release/pihpsdr/libwdsp.so b/release/pihpsdr/libwdsp.so
index 375b8c7..744bf4b 100755
Binary files a/release/pihpsdr/libwdsp.so and b/release/pihpsdr/libwdsp.so differ
diff --git a/release/pihpsdr/pihpsdr b/release/pihpsdr/pihpsdr
index 989756a..31fb43b 100755
Binary files a/release/pihpsdr/pihpsdr and b/release/pihpsdr/pihpsdr differ
diff --git a/release/pihpsdr/splash.png b/release/pihpsdr/splash.png
deleted file mode 100644
index 4b249eb..0000000
Binary files a/release/pihpsdr/splash.png and /dev/null differ
diff --git a/release/pihpsdr/start_pihpsdr.sh b/release/pihpsdr/start_pihpsdr.sh
deleted file mode 100755
index 98af331..0000000
--- a/release/pihpsdr/start_pihpsdr.sh
+++ /dev/null
@@ -1,2 +0,0 @@
-cd ~/pihpsdr
-sudo ~/pihpsdr/pihpsdr